Mercurity Fintech Holding Inc. has secured a $200 million credit from SolanaSOL-- Ventures Ltd. to implement a new digital assetDAAQ-- treasury strategy. This strategic partnership aims to leverage Solana's blockchain technology, focusing on the accumulation of SOL tokens, staking, decentralized finance (DeFi) protocols, and real-world asset (RWA) tokenization. The initiative is designed to drive liquidity and encourage capital inflows into Solana-based platforms and associated projects, potentially enhancing Solana's market presence and activity.

The collaboration between Mercurity FintechMFH-- and Solana Ventures underscores a growing trend in the digital asset space, where traditional financial institutionsFISI-- are increasingly exploring blockchain technology to diversify their investment portfolios and tap into new revenue streams. By establishing a high-value digital asset reserve, Mercurity Fintech aims to earn yields through staking, validator nodes, and DeFi protocols, while also investing in real-world assets and tokenized products within the Solana ecosystem.

This move is part of a broader strategy by Mercurity Fintech to expand its digital asset engagement and capitalize on the growing interest in blockchain-enabled financial solutions. The company's Chief Strategy Officer, Wilfred Daye, brings over two decades of leadership experience in structured credit trading and financial innovation, having previously served as CEO of Securitize Capital, a pioneer in RWA tokenization. Daye's expertise is expected to play a crucial role in the successful implementation of this new digital asset treasury strategy.
